Guide to Traditional Day Camps 2024

Camp is where children gain confidence, responsibility and independence, not to mention great new friends that can last a lifetime. Camp offers a safe and appropriate environment where they can learn new skills, experience decision making, and relish in the joys of summer! 

In and around New Jersey, we have many great options for general day camps or traditional day camps, many of which provide a broad general camp experience with an excellent array of activities. Many of these camps are located outside in the wooded mountains or among acres of recreational fields and nature grounds; many are equipped with water sports, maybe even a lake, full athletics capabilities as well as arts and stem programs. Others may be located in a school or college campus, and still provide a wide range of activities, including a nice mix of academics intermingled within a fun setting. You'll find a full staff ready to provide a safe and nurturing environment.
